Position Overview

This position will manage complex capital projects directly related to the manufacturing of PET preforms and rigid containers. Review new products from a manufacturing perspective; manage multiple projects at multiple sites from conception to qualification with overall responsibility for productivity, timing and budget. Support productivity and cost reduction projects within manufacturing locations.

Essential Responsibilities And Duties
  • Create bills of materials for new capital projects and provide support for the capital appropriation process.
  • Ensure that corporate safety and environmental requirements are incorporated into the project scope and budget.
  • Upon approval, refine feasibility studies, with input from Regional Directors, Plant Managers and Plant resources, into a mutually acceptable action implementation plan, which meets cost and timing criteria.
  • Review plant infrastructure, layout and equipment against project requirements. Develop and manage plans for upgrades and expansion requirements.
  • Analyze and evaluate the performance and cost of new, proposed or existing equipment. Includes evaluation of machinery, tooling, work flow, and vendors.
  • Communicate and resolve technical, timing and budgetary issues related to projects as they arise. Publish weekly project status reports outlining projects status and issues.
  • Create and maintain division level technical specifications, standards and documentation for Operations Engineering department.
  • Communicate with plants on a regular basis to understand long term project performance and support resolution of plant issues.
  • Review and comment on plant CEAV requests to ensure accuracy and compliance to standards.
  • Travel ~60%
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s degree or equivalent in mechanical or electrical engineering.
  • Minimum of seven years professional engineering experience in the plastics packaging industry, including seven years of project management experience. Knowledge of plant layouts and infrastructure equipment. Proven experience managing multiple resources and complex projects.
  • Strong interpersonal skills to communicate technical information and to complete project assignments.
  • Strong management, communication and people skills required to influence and manage multiple resources, most of which do not report to the senior program manager.
  • Experience managing direct reports
  • Strong technical, analytical and problem solving skills.
  • Able to work independently with minimal supervision.
  • Experience in evaluating on-site manufacturing opportunities and managing on-site projects from concept to completion.
  • Experience with SPC.
